An expert locksmith can offer a variety of services to assist you with your car keys. Here are a few of the most typical services:
Key Duplication: This service includes developing a specific copy of your existing car key. It's uncomplicated for standard metal keys but can be more complicated for keys with electronic components.Key Programming: Many contemporary cars have transponder keys that require to be programmed to the vehicle's computer. A locksmith can program a new key to guarantee it works perfectly with your car.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can securely remove it without triggering damage to the lock or the vehicle.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is harmed or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, making sure that your vehicle remains safe and secure.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ance: In the event that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can provide fast and efficient support to get you back in.Tips for Choosing the Right LocksmithCheck Credentials: Verify that the locksmith is licensed and certified. This ensures that they have the required training and know-how to manage your scenario.Check out Reviews: Look for customer evaluations and reviews to determine the locksmith's track record and reliability.Request References: If possible, ask the locksmith for references from previous customers. This can offer extra insight into their service quality.Compare Prices: Get numerous quotes to compare costs and services. Watch out for extremely low rates, as they may indicate subpar service.Inquire about Insurance: Ensure that the locksmith has insurance coverage to cover any damages that may happen during the service.Inspect Availability: Find out if the locksmith provides 24/7 emergency situation services. This can be important if you lose your keys beyond regular business hours.Common Car Key Problems and SolutionsLost Car Keys: This is the most common issue. A locksmith can develop a brand-new key based upon your vehicle's make and model.Broken Car Keys: If your key breaks in the lock, a locksmith can extract the broken piece and produce a brand-new key.Lost Key Fob: Modern key fobs can be pricey to replace at a car dealership. A locksmith can often provide a more cost effective solution by programming a new fob.Stuck Ignition Key: Sometimes, the key gets stuck in the ignition. A locksmith can assist eliminate it securely without triggering damage to the vehicle.Keyless Entry Issues: If your keyless entry system stops working, a locksmith can detect the problem and provide an option, such as reprogramming the system or replacing the battery.Frequently asked questions About Finding a Cheap Locksmith for Car Keys
Q: How much does a locksmith typically charge for car key services?A: The cost can vary depending on the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a traditional metal key can cost in between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ency services may be more expensive, but numerous locksmiths offer flat rates or discount rates.

Q: Can a locksmith replace a lost key fob?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can replace a lost key fob. They can program a brand-new fob to deal with your vehicle's system, typically at a lower cost than a dealer.

Q: What should I do if my key breaks in the lock?A: If your key breaks in the lock, do not try to force it out. Call a locksmith who can securely extract the broken piece and create a brand-new key for you.

Q: Are locksmiths available 24/7?A: Many locksmiths use 24/7 emergency situation services. It's an excellent concept to ask about their availability when you call them.

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to show up?A: The arrival time can vary depending on the locksmith's schedule and your location. Many locksmith professionals aim to get here within 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Can a locksmith aid with keyless entry systems?A: Yes, a locksmith can assist with keyless entry systems. They can diagnose problems, replace batteries, and reprogram the system if needed.
